Rob Ayling writes: 

"Thom the World poet is an old mate of mine from way back in my history. Even pre-dating Voiceprint, when I was running "Otter Songs" and Tom's poetry tapes and guest appearances with Daevid Allen, Gilli Smyth, Mother Gong are well known and highly regarded. It just felt right to include a daily poem from Thom on our Gonzo blog and when I approached him to do so, he replied with in seconds!!! Thom is a great talent and just wants to spread poetry, light and positive energy across the globe. If we at Gonzo can help him do that - why not? why not indeed!!" (The wondrous poetpic is by Jack McCabe, who I hope forgives me for scribbling all over it with Photoshop)

BEFORE YOU BEGIN YOUR RITES OF PASSAGE

make sure you are clear via will or document
what you will want done with your body.Revive?or release?
have signed sheets with neighbors/friends/family
so your intentions can be honored if you are inarticulate
Let those close know where your will is/and the contents therein
For when 911 is called,all your bank accounts will be frozen
Dying affects everyone.It is no secret.Intimate experience?-yes-but still public
You will have granted your power of attorney to a trusted soul
Have a PLAN B for  if they precede you in the Great Chain of Release
Authorities will all have to be notified-as each spirit leaves
doctors,dentists,lawyers,church communities all need to know
Otherwise ghost emails/junk mail/bills will overflow
O!Yes-if you are preparing for departure
Give plenty of notice for the future...
